The Dallas Mavericks kicked off a new era with the highly anticipated debut of All-Star forward Anthony Davis, and boy, did he make a statement! In an electrifying matchup against the Houston Rockets, Davis shone brightly, pouring in an impressive 26 points along with 16 rebounds, seven assists, and three blocks in just 31 minutes of court time. The crowd was on their feet as the Mavericks seemed poised for a triumphant victory, leading comfortably until a non-contact injury cut his electrifying performance short in the closing moments of the third quarter.
As it turned out, the Mavs had a backup plan, and despite the grim scene of Davis hobbling off the court, they managed to secure a solid victory, finishing the game at 116-105. The Rockets, struggling to find their rhythm, marked their sixth consecutive loss here, with the defeat only adding to the woes of an already beleaguered franchise. The fans had mixed feelings, both thrilled with the win and anxious about Davisโs injury status moving forward.
